Visitation Policy

There will be no visits in the Madras City Jail.

You will have to wait until arrestees transfer to the Jefferson County Adult Detention Center at 675 NW Cherry Lane, Madras, OR, 97741. Call the jail administration at 541-475-2869 to make prior arrangements.
